Exegesis

Miktsot {מִקְצֹות | miqṣôṯ} ‘extremities’ highlights selection from society’s margins.

In context1 Kings 13:33

After this event Jeroboam did not turn back from his evil way, but again made priests from the lowest ranks of the people for the high places ; whoever desired it he filled his hand and became a priest of the high places.
